Narendra Jadhav
Narendra Damodar Jadhav is an Indian economist, educationist, public policy expert, professor and writer in English, Marathi and Hindi.
Jadhav has been a Member of the Rajya Sabha, the upper house of Indian Parliament. He previously served as member of the Planning Commission of India and the National Advisory Council. Prior to this, he worked as Vice Chancellor of Savitribai Phule Pune University, International Monetary Fund and headed economic research at the Reserve Bank of India.
Early life and education
Narendra Damodar Jadhav was born on 28 May 1953 to a Mahar family from the village of Ozar and grew up in Mumbai suburb of Wadala. In 1956, his family converted to Buddhism. He attended Chhabildas High School, Dadar. He completed his Bachelor of Science in Statistics from Ramnarain Ruia College, University of Mumbai in 1973 and Master of Arts in Economics from the University of Mumbai in 1975. He later earned a PhD in Economics from Indiana University Bloomington, United States in 1986.Professional career
Economist
As a career economist, Jadhav worked for 31 years with the Reserve Bank of India, and those of Afghanistan and Ethiopia. He also worked as Adviser in the International Monetary Fund for over four years. He retired in October 2008 from the position of Principal Adviser and Chief Economist of the RBI. His writings on economics include: Ambedkar – An Economist Extraordinaire, Monetary Policy, Financial Stability and Central Banking in India, Re-emerging India – A Global Perspective and Monetary Economics for India.Education
In 2006, Jadhav was appointed Vice Chancellor of the University of Pune.Planning Commission
As a Member of the Planning Commission, Jadhav had a role in formulating the 12th Five Year Plan, especially in respect of Education and Skill Development. His contribution to formulation of the Rashtriya Uchchatar Shiksha Abhiyan scheme and developing the eco-system for Skills Development in India has been recognised. Equally noteworthy is his contribution to social justice through the Scheduled Caste Sub-Plan, Tribal Sub-Plan and Assessment and Monitoring Authority for socio-religious communities.National Advisory Council
As a Member of the National Advisory Council Jadhav's notable contributions include formulation of National Food Security Bill, implementation of the Right to Education Act 2009, and empowerment of SC, ST, Minorities and Denotified Nomadic Tribes through education, SC & ST Prevention of Atrocities, Rights of persons with Disabilities, Child Labour and Abolition of Manual Scavenging.Member of Parliament
In 2022, Jadhav completed his first term as an independent Member of Parliament in the Rajya Sabha.Writings
Jadhav, has written or edited 41 books in three languages – 21 in English, 13 in Marathi, and 7 in Hindi, besides over 300 research papers and articles. These include 21 books on Babasaheb Ambedkar and a trilogy on Rabindranath Tagore, comprising an analytical biography, and translation of selected poems, short stories, plays, parodies, articles and speeches.English books
